Associate Technical Support Analyst

Forest
London

A bit about Forest

We’re Forest. You know, those shared ebikes in London that look like trees. We’re London’s most sustainable shared ebike operator. We bridge the gap between affordability and sustainability, using advertising revenue to offer our users up to 30 free minutes per ride. Our mission is to help cities move greener, and we’re growing fast.

A bit about the role

This role sits at the intersection of Product and Engineering, helping us understand, investigate and resolve issues with the Forest app and wider product. You’ll be the first point of investigation for bugs, reproducing problems, digging into what’s happening, and making sure Engineering has the information they need to take action. It’s a great role for someone early in their career who’s naturally curious, technically minded and gets satisfaction from figuring out why something isn’t working.

Your key responsibilities include:

  • Triage incoming bug reports: reproduce, check severity, spot duplicates

  • Write clear tickets: steps to reproduce, expected vs actual behaviour, environment details, screenshots or logs where relevant

  • Assist with the beta group (Forest Explorers): onboarding, communication, chasing feedback, flagging when engagement drops, triaging issues

  • Communicate with the Customer Support team when users need escalation

  • Provide first-line technical support to riders and internal teams when issues come in, escalating to the QA Lead when needed

  • Spot patterns across reports that might point to a bigger underlying problem

  • Keep documentation and known-issue lists up to date

  • Assist in monitoring app metrics in Production

Who you are:

  • Sharp attention to detail. You notice the thing everyone else scrolled past

  • Honest. If something's broken, half-checked, or you're not sure, you say so

  • Hard-working and reliable.

  • Comfortable with technical concepts. You don't need to code, but you should be able to read logs, understand API responses, and talk to engineers without translation

  • Clear written communication.

  • Good communication skills. You'll need to interact with non-technical stakeholders and explain to them the status of different bug reports.

  • Genuine problem-solving instinct. You want to know why something broke, not just that it did

  • You'll need to hold several threads at once and know when something's urgent versus when it can wait. We'd rather you push back and ask a hard question than quietly guess.

Bonus but not essential:

  • Experience working with and debugging APIs and Webhooks (JSON,YAML).

  • Some experience with Data Analysis

  • Experience using AI on a user level

  • Past experience with writing clear tickets with Linear or a similar issue tracker

  • Some exposure to customer or technical support
